Construction and Design
The mattress is a hybrid that measures 13.5″ thick. It makes use of both foam and coils. It is made up of the following layers as well as a cover.
Extra Edge Support
The base layer is made of dense poly based foam. This serves as the foundation for the mattress. With a foundation this dense it isn’t necessary to worry about sliding or falling off the mattress.
Pocketed Coils
The next layer is comprised of coils that are pocketed, which contribute to the overall stability of the mattress.
Transition Layer
The layer is comprised of 2″ in diameter of microcoils. These coils maximize air flow and are vital for temperature control as well as off-gassing.
Comfort Layer
Comfort layer is cushion top made of polyfoam that has been infused with gel. This layer is responsible for motion transfer, making you less likely to be disrupted by any movement.The foam also aids in the mattress’ cooling factor. Winkbed King

Off-Gassing
In the simplest way off-gassing refers to the process whereby the volatile organic compound (VOCs) permeates out of a recently opened product. VOCs create strong carbon based gasses that have a strong odor.
This is typically the case when purchasing the mattress. The scent can sometimes last for days and weeks. This can irritate your nose especially if you are sensitive to these types of powerful scents.
The Winkbed isn’t an exception but you don’t need to be concerned about the smell not staying its welcome. Because of the coils inside, the regulation of airflow is much more flexible which means that the smell can leave the mattress more quickly. Winkbed King

Where can I find the Winkbed Available?
The Winkbed mattress can be purchased in all of the United States. It is shipped via UPS and usually takes two to three weeks to arrive.
What is the best way to test the Winkbed in a store?
You’re in luck as you can test the mattress in a physical store. They are available in showrooms throughout New York City, Chicago, Illinois; Edina, Minnesota and Austin, Texas.
Is a trial period available?
Still unsure with making a final purchase, be assured that a trial period is also available. Customers have the opportunity to try it out for themselves. The trial period is 120 nights. Customers are able to claim a full refund if the mattress isn’t satisfactory as long as they test it out for at least 30 days.
Customers can also swap their mattress with one that is of their preferred degree of firmness. They’ll get the opportunity to try it out.
Do you have a warranty?
Winkbed gives a life-time limited warranty. The warranty is valid for customers for as long as they purchase through an approved retailer, as well as save the receipt.
The warranty covers manufacturing defects but not the manufacturing process but does not cover for damage from neglect.
